How they compare
Luxembourg currently reports 1.0% against 1.0% in Sweden, a difference of 0.0%.
That makes Luxembourg's figure about 1.1 times Sweden's.
The two have swapped places 17 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Sweden ahead.
Luxembourg ranks 170th and Sweden ranks 173rd of 212 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Luxembourg averaged higher in 5 and Sweden in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Luxembourg | Sweden |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 2.8% | 2.4% | 0.3% | Luxembourg |
| 1980s | 4.6% | 2.3% | 2.3% | Luxembourg |
| 1990s | 4.7% | 1.8% | 2.9% | Luxembourg |
| 2000s | 3.3% | 2.0% | 1.3% | Luxembourg |
| 2010s | 2.5% | 2.5% | 0.0% | Luxembourg |
| 2020s | 1.1% | 1.3% | 0.1% | Sweden |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
